Planning Your Couples' Weekend

Book a bed-and-breakfast or boutique hotel with vineyard views. Plan three to four winery visits per day, leaving time for long lunches and spontaneous detours. Bring a journal or camera; the landscapes and quiet moments between tastings are what you will remember most. End each day with a bottle of something you discovered together.
